IDENTITY
CAS Number:18559-94-9
MDL Number:MFCD00148978
MF:C13H21NO3
MW:239.31
EINECS:242-424-0
BRN:6405698
SPECIFICATIONS & PROPERTIES
Min. Purity Spec:99% (HPLC)
Physical Form (at 20°C):Solid
Melting Point:157-166°C
Long-Term Storage:Store long-term at 2-8°C
DOT/IATA TRANSPORT INFORMATION
Not hazardous material

BIOLOGICAL INFO
Solubility:Soluble in most organic solvents
Application(s):Short-acting beta-2-adrenergic receptor agonist

REVIEW

 Salbutamol is a beta(2)-adrenergic agonist and thus it stimulates beta(2)-adrenergic receptors. Binding of albuterol to beta(2)-receptors in the lungs results in relaxation of bronchial smooth muscles. It is believed that salbutamol increases cAMP production by activating adenylate cyclase, and the actions of salbutamol are mediated by cAMP. Increased intracellular cyclic AMP increases the activity of cAMP-dependent protein kinase A, which inhibits the phosphorylation of myosin and lowers intracellular calcium concentrations. A lowered intracellular calcium concentration leads to a smooth muscle relaxation and bronchodilation. In addition to bronchodilation, salbutamol inhibits the release of bronchoconstricting agents from mast cells, inhibits microvascular leakage, and enhances mucociliary clearance.
